...if Joe Montana's teams were playing today people would say the same stuff:

- Doesn't have a big arm
- Kind of smallish (1.5 inches taller than Purdy)
- Not a high draft pick (3rd round #82)
- Gets all his yards from Jerry Rice YAC, short passes (this is actually BS even as a fact...Purdy's % of yards from YAC is around the same as every other good QB)
- Has a great team/system/coach around him

Just sayin'
49ers are #5 for total yardage after catch and #1 for ratio of yards after catch so not like every other good QB. Another stat that catches my eye is the 49ers have the lowest percentage of dropped passes in the league and it's not close.

49ers are #5 for total yardage after catch and #1 for ratio of yards after catch so not like every other good QB. Another stat that catches my eye is the 49ers have the lowest percentage of dropped passes in the league and it's not close.
According to Mike Sando of the Athletic, 48.5% of Purdy's passing yards have come after the catch. That's a tick above the NFL average (47%), but still below each of the last three MVP winners, including Patrick Mahomes in 2022 (54%).

4th read? Was it a prevent defense or what? Who has that kind of time to throw in the NFL?
Yes, as @Jikkle pointed out, Deebo was Purdy's 4th read on the play. Not prevent at all--Philly has a 5 man rush coming as part of a fire zone blitz.
